Now I'm convinced.But yeah, you guessed it - I'm a Sonar user!!!It seems strange that as most pro's are using Macs, Cakewalk haven't gone into that market.I'd be interested to hear which sequencers you all using on your Macs, and how they compare to Sonar.It's not true that most pro's are using Macs. That may have been the case in the old days but PCs users have probably purpassed the number of Mac users.If you read interviews in magazines with pro musicians and producers you'd be suprised how few actually use Macs.From my experience, the photography, design and advertising worlds tend to use Macs, but, Macs are definately not the industry standard for music production.I'd say that in my experince Pro Tools is the industry standard for music editing. It's really easy to transport sessions from one studio to the next using Pro Tools.I use and love Sonar, but, I get the impression that it is really a home user/producer package. I'd be interested to know if there are any studios that actually use it as their main DAW. If you believe the advertising blurb and reviews then you'd think that Sonar is the most powerful tool out there, but, somehow I doubt it. I think the price tag on Pro tools makes it 'reassuringly' expensive for studios.I worked for a major audio content provider which used Pro Tools. Every studio they worked with around the world also used Pro Tools as standard (only the crappy cowboy studios tended to use programmes that weren't compatible).If you plan on sending sessions across the world for collaborations then I'd say Pro Tools is your best bet for compatability.Now, I await the backlash!

No need to flame anybody. We all have different experiences and make choices accordingly Saying that "all the pros" use [insert favorite pro gear] is dangerous statement. However, what I can say from my experience visiting local studios that do major label recording is that they all have Protools and use it as the primary way to transfer sessions.I can also say that personally I have less problems with the Mac audio sub-system. And I'm the kind of guy who always had more than 3 PCs at any given time. I just don't do audio on them.Even when I go to Japan, I'm suprised to see that they too use ProTools as well as a bunch of funky stuff I've never heard of, but for music always a Mac.Vermeer

I don't think anybody would disagree if I call myself one of the more "Pro" taxi members , and I use a PC and Cubase.If you're having problems with your PC that you can't seem to fix no matter what you do, then maybe you should consider giving the Mac a try. But don't switch because a bunch of people are telling you "Pro's use Mac's"...that would be ridiculous. And if you use Sonar and love it and have become fast on it, I certainly wouldn't switch. I'd get a PC custom built for audio. Sure that erases the price difference between PC and Mac...but just like many Logic PC users switched to Mac when Apple bought Emagic, paying a bit of extra money to be able to work efficiently with the software you love is a good investment for sure.That being said I've used stock Dells for year with no problems whatsoever other than the fact that they're noisy...but so are many Macs.matto
